Tampa Florida Kenworth is currently accepting applications for Entry level and Experienced Diesel Truck Mechanics. Responsibilities include the repair, troubleshooting and maintenance of Class 8 trucks. Candidates must be mechanically inclined and experienced technicians must have 3-5 years experience. Responsibilities:




  • Performs corrective and preventative maintenance on medium and heavy duty vehicles.

  • Troubleshoots various systems, to include electrical, drive train, HVAC, brake, engine, and suspension, identifies needed repairs and performs corrective action.

  • Writes up on the repair order an accurate, clear, and detailed description of the cause of failure and the repair procedure(s) used.



Primary Duties:




  • Uses diagnostic equipment to detect and isolate faults in medium and heavy duty vehicles and interprets test results.

  • Reads written fault description on Repair Order and determines the most efficient repair procedure.

  • Communicates with and provides Shop Foreman with accurate and detailed repair information for inclusion on the Repair Order.

  • Obtains supervisor permission to complete diagnosed repairs and/or add additional repairs to a repair.

  • Communicates with parts department personnel to obtain or order the parts necessary to repair vehicles.

  • Performs road test on customer vehicles to assist in problem isolation or to verify repair procedure.

  • Tracks and charges clocked hours to the proper corresponding Repair Order operation.

  • Writes up clear, accurate, and detailed repair description of each operation on the corresponding Repair Order, to include a description of the cause of failure and the correction and/or repair procedure used.

  • Interacts with customers in a professional and positive manner.

  • Assists other technicians with repair procedures as needed.


Qualifications



  • High School Diploma required; Formal technical degree, certificate or equivalent work experience is preferred

  • Experienced technicians must have at least 3-5 years of diesel mechanic experience

  • Personal tool inventory to allow for the completion of job duties and assignments.

  • Effective written and oral communication skills.

  • Ability to obtain a Valid Commercial Drivers License (CDL).

  • Ability to read and interpret shop repair order forms, repair manuals, electrical schematics and various other technical bulletins.

  • Ability to use computer keyboard and Windows basics.

  • Ability to work in an environment with frequent exposure to outside weather elements.

  • Ability to work 8 - 10 hour days, including overtime hours as needed.

  • Ability to bend, stoop, crawl, walk and sit on a regular basis with frequent lifting of up to 50 pounds and occasional lifting of up to 100 pounds
